Online Report - First Steps

See the dotGrants User Manual for more detailed instruction on how to use the online reporting system.

    1. Submit an EALA and Resolution for approval to BMS
      Before a municipality can gain access to dotGrants, an EALA and Municipal Resolution are required. Once approved, the municipality will be notified by BMS.

    2. Identify an Authorizing Official (AO) for your municipality
      Review the dotGrants Roles and identify at least one executive-level municipal official who can serve as the Authorized Official for your municipality.

    3. Create a new user account for the AO
      Go to the online dotGrants system log-in page and review the “
      New User Registration Guide”. Click on “New User?” in the LOGIN box, complete your Contact Information and Save. Please remember to enter your Municipality name in the Organization box as well as type your 5-digit dotCode behind your Last name. (i.e Thomas -54103)

    4. Have the AO validated by BMS
      Contact the Bureau of Municipal Services by phone at 717-783-3719 or
      email:
      ra-lf-penndot_boms@pa.gov to be validated as the Authorized Official for your municipality.

    5. Create a new report
      Once logged in, an Authorized Official may initiate a new Liquid Fuels report following instructions provided in the dotGrants User Manual.

    6. AO assigns other roles
      Follow instructions provided in the “
      New User Activating Guide for Authorizing Officials on the log-in page to assign Viewers to your forms.

    7. Begin Report
      Log-in with your username and password and begin work on the forms, following guidance in the Report Instructions.
